FACILITATION OF IMPAIRED DRIVING TASK FORCE <br /> CONTINUED WORKING ON GOALS ESTABLISHED BY THE TASK FORCE <br /> THROUGH THE DEVELOPMENT, PROMOTION AND IMPLEMENTATION OF <br /> EFFECTIVE EDUCATION AND ENFORCEMENT PROGRAMS AND POLICIES TO <br /> REDUCE IMPAIRED DRIVING IN HAWAII COUNTY. <br /> To reach the goals of the task force, subcommittees were formed and meetings were <br /> held throughout the year: Criminal Justice subcommittee (4 meetings conducted), <br /> Safe Ride Subcommittee (4 meetings conducted) in addition to the impaired driving <br /> task force meeting. <br /> ? REDUCE NUMBER OF IMPAIRED DRIVING FATALITIES BY 10% <br /> During this grant period, there were a total of 35 fatalities; 12 involved alcohol, 8 <br /> involved drugs, 5 fatalities involved both drugs and alcohol. 18 of the fatalities <br /> were free of any substances.* statistics as of 10/19/07; test results of recent <br /> fatality cases still pending. 51% of fatalities involved alcohol and/or drugs <br /> During last grant period, there were a total of 37 fatalities; 13 alcohol related; 11 <br /> involved drugs; 4 involved both alcohol and other drugs. 15 fatalities were free of <br /> any substances. 59.5% of the fatalities involved alcohol and/or drugs. <br /> There has been a 8.5% decrease since last grant period. <br /> ? INCREASE NUMBER OF DUI ARRESTS <br /> During this grant period, there was a total of 1251 DUI arrests in Hawaii county <br /> compared to 1127 during the same period last year, an increase of 11 % . <br /> ? INCREASE NUMBER OF DUI CONVICTIONS <br /> A Criminal Justice subcommittee was formed as a result of the task force's goals. <br /> This subcommittee consisted of members from the prosecutor's office, court <br /> monitoring project and police to formulate ways to improve processing of DUI <br /> cases. <br /> Results from Court Monitoring Project still pending review and evaluation from <br /> task force. <br /> <br />
